i have a hud but just bought a anlog ??

will it work cause i have a 91 nissan hud and i'm about to buy a 92 anlog gauge cluster will i run in to any problems, or will it even work.

When you swap from digital to analog or vice versa, you have to swap the instrument harness with it. It's a short harness running from the cluster to the main harness. Just plug and play.
